What we observed in this categoryauto-generated

Brisbane Plastic & Cosmetic Surgery (bpcs.com.au) and Brisbane Plastic Surgery (brisbaneplasticsurgery.com.au) jointly lead with identical visibility scores of 12.5% and composite scores of 8.8, both new entrants having risen from 0% visibility in the previous period. Every other brand in the 10-brand category sits at 0% visibility, making the gap between the top two and the rest absolute rather than marginal. With a category average visibility of just 2.5%, the two leaders account for all measurable AI presence in Google AI Mode.

The most striking divergence between visibility and citation belongs to North East Plastic Surgery (northeastplasticsurgery.com.au), which holds 0% visibility yet records a 25% citation rate — the highest citation figure in the entire category. This means the AI is referencing North East Plastic Surgery as a source or recommendation without surfacing it as a named brand in direct responses. The two joint leaders show the inverse pattern: 12.5% visibility each but 0% citation, indicating they are named in AI outputs but not used as source material.

Google AI Mode is the sole engine recorded across all 10 brands, confirming this category's AI visibility landscape is entirely dependent on a single engine. Notably, none of the top cited sources in the category are the brands themselves — the AI anchors on third-party platforms including google.com, realself.com, m.yelp.com, and review or directory sites such as plastic-surgery-brisbane.com.au and stylemagazines.com.au. This suggests the AI is synthesising category responses from aggregator and review content rather than from the practices' own domains.

How to read this ranking

Four things worth knowing before you act on the numbers above. These are the same definitions across every industry page — for category-specific observations, see the What we observed section above (where available) and the per-brand insights inline in the ranking.

Visibility = being named

A brand's visibility % is the share of AI answers that mention it by name in the response prose. This is who AI engines actively recommend to the buyer.

Citation rate = being trusted

Citation rate is the share of AI answers that include the brand's domain as a clickable source link. This is what the AI treats as authoritative evidence — different from being named.

Top engine differs by brand

The "top engine" column shows which AI surface each brand performs best on. Big gaps between a brand's score across engines usually points to specific content or schema gaps.

Rankings move month to month

AI engines re-crawl and re-rank on shorter cycles than classical search. We re-audit every brand on this list at least every 30 days and refresh this page automatically.
